Does your computer usually lag when recording? Sometimes you just have to change the encoder settings in OBS in order for it to work. Either that or your computer doesn't have enough memory to run it. If this is the case try CamStudio http://camstudio.org/ it's free and easy to use/setup. The only thing is you have to make sure your video output settings are correct! If you don't know how to just look it up on the website or youtube.
